Job ResponsibilitiesAssist the Superintendent with daily field operations on commercial concrete projects.
Coordinate subcontractors, crews, equipment, and material deliveries.
Monitor project schedules to keep work progressing safely and efficiently.
Ensure work is completed according to plans, specifications, and quality standards.
Promote and enforce company safety procedures.
Participate in daily planning meetings and coordinate with Project Managers.
Assist with scheduling inspections, punch lists, and project closeout activities.
Build strong relationships with owners, general contractors, inspectors, and field personnel.
2+ years of experience as an Assistant Superintendent, Foreman, Lead Foreman, or similar leadership role with a commercial concrete contractor.
Experience with commercial concrete construction, including slabs, foundations, tilt-up, podium, or structural concrete.
Ability to read and interpret construction drawings.
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ills.
Willingness to travel to projects throughout the Charlotte and Charleston markets as business needs dictate.
Val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
